Studio Ghibli Museum

There is a museum in Japan for the Studio Ghibli films that they have made over the last few years and they have some of the characters in the museum like the cat bus from My Neighbour Totoro.

The location of the museum is in Shimorenjaku, Mikata, Tokyo.

 Hayao Miyzaki is the one who design the museum by looking at the drawn storyboards from the movies that he has made. Hayao Miyazaki look at all the different storyboards from the movies that he created and make the characters from the movie.

They make the cat bus from My Neighbour Totoro so little kids can play in it and they can enjoy themselves while their parents can watch them.

The museum have a life size robot from Laputa: Castle in the Sky.
